Can GeForce GTX 1060 run Delivering Letters?
GreatThe GeForce GTX 1060 handles Delivering Letters well at 1080p, delivering approximately 91 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 68 FPS.
Delivering Letters – GeForce GTX 1060 FPS Data
| Quality | 1080p | 1440p | 4K |
|---|---|---|---|
| Low | 143 fps | 107 fps | 57 fps |
| Medium | 114 fps | 86 fps | 46 fps |
| High | 91 fps | 68 fps | 37 fps |
| Ultra | 74 fps | 56 fps | 30 fps |
Estimated FPS · actual performance may vary based on drivers and settings

About
Delivering Letters, released in 2022, is an engaging action-adventure indie game where players embark on the simple yet charming task of delivering ten letters. With its unique premise and straightforward gameplay, players find themselves navigating through various environments and overcoming obstacles, making it an enjoyable experience for gamers of all skill levels.
In terms of PC performance, Delivering Letters is highly accessible and can run efficiently on entry-level hardware. For optimal performance, a minimum GPU score of around 8808 is recommended, which allows players to achieve respectable FPS even at lower graphics settings. With just 8 GB of RAM, most budget or mid-range PCs should handle the game smoothly, making it a great choice for gamers without high-end systems.
